1. Probable Cause / Reason:
• Stress-related failure due to surface movement or changes.
• Aging of the coating, absorption, and desorption of moisture.
• Lack of flexibility in the coating, leading to brittleness.
• Thicker paint films have a higher risk of cracking under stress.
2. Correction:
• Use appropriate coating systems with better flexibility.
• Ensure proper application techniques and control dry-film thickness.
• Apply coatings in multiple thinner layers instead of one thick coat.
• Address environmental factors like moisture or temperature changes during application.
3. Corrective Action / Prevention:
• Remove the cracked paint film and inspect the underlying substrate.
• Reapply a more flexible coating system to avoid future cracking.
• Regularly inspect and maintain the coating to monitor for early signs of stress.
